GCA-MIGA Focused Masterclass on Climate Resilient Infrastructures
Context and Objectives
GCA and MIGA have initiated a pilot collaboration, for GCA to support MIGA in the enhancement and simplification of climate adaptation objectives and considerations in the steps previous and during Due Diligence process to help climate mainstreaming and business development, based on specific support under discussion for two specific operations in the energy sector, both from the real sector, one with a transaction-based approach and one with a counter party approach.
As a kick-off of the GCA support, MIGA and GCA are co-developing a capacity building initiative to support MIGA underwriters developing a foundational understanding on why integrating climate adaptation and resilience considerations are relevant for MIGA business and our clients. The capacity building initiative will build on GCA Masterclass on Climate Resilience Infrastructure PPP, complemented with case studies discussion to be provided by MIGA. Altogether, this capacity building initiative will enhance reciprocal understanding of MIGA climate considerations and underwriters’ role, in relation to the integration of climate adaptation considerations and targets.
Specific objectives for the capacity building initiative:
- Cover basic concepts of climate risks and resilience and climate adaptation options prioritization in investment projects.
- Provide a structured rationale and approach to integrating climate risks into investment decisions, covering due diligence practices, scenario-based decision-making, and effective communication strategies with investors and clients.
- Discuss MIGA case studies and ways to integrate climate adaptation within MIGA pipeline, in line with MIGA clients objectives and constraints.
About the Masterclass
The Masterclass is part of the Knowledge Module on PPPs for Climate Resilient Infrastructure, developed by GCA together with MDBs and other technical partners and leveraging GCA experience developed under the African Adaptation Acceleration Program. Designed to build the capacity of PPP practitioners to mainstream adaptation and resilience into infrastructure PPP projects, the Knowledge Module also includes the Climate Resilient Infrastructure Handbook and the Certified Climate-Resilient Infrastructure Officer (CRIO) program.
